Drag and drop websites to desktop
I used to do this all the time in Firefox, in which you could drag and drop any of the following; the content of the website; the bookmark link; the address bar; the logo next to the address bar; the tab, etc. In Opera, none of these actually work, it just takes the tab into its own new window so I have to copy the address into Firefox and then drag and drop from there. Is there anyway to drag and drop websites (i.e. the link to a website) onto my desktop from Opera?Clicking on and dragging the address in the address bar lets you put that on the desktop.
For a link on a page click on it and move your pointer up the way before dragging to the desktop.

When I drag and drop from the address bar to the desktop in Windows 7, it creates an *.url file which seems to be permanently attached to Internet Explorer.
Trying to change the association to Opera through "Default Programs" does not work. Is this because I have Opera installed on my D partition?
Edit: Even though the interface for default programs STILL shows Internet Explorer as the default program, the .url opens in Opera. So I guess it works after a fashion.
